01Agent Graphs

Multi-Agent Graph & State Machine Debugging

Follow the execution flow across complex LangGraph state machines, CrewAI agent handoffs, and hierarchical supervisor patterns.

  • Visualize state mutations and memory context across turns
  • Identify why an agent chose a specific tool over others
  • Break down latency between LLM generation and external tool APIs
02Failure Forensics

Root-Cause Failure Analysis & Trace Replay

Diagnose why an agent hallucinated, failed a tool schema, or entered an infinite loop using step-by-step trace replay.

  • Filter production runs by status (Success, Error, Blocked, Timeout)
  • Compare failed execution traces against golden baseline runs
  • Export failed traces directly to evaluation datasets for regression testing
03FinOps Insight

Unified Performance & Cost Attribution

Correlate reasoning depth, token consumption, and response accuracy with real dollar costs across all models and tools.

  • Attribute cost down to individual sub-agents and reasoning loops
  • Track Anthropic and OpenAI prompt cache utilization
  • Enforce hard spending and step limits to terminate runaway loops

Frequently Asked Questions

How does Splyntra handle multi-turn conversations and long-running agents?
Splyntra groups spans under a unified `session_id` and `trace_id`, allowing you to inspect both individual step latency and the cumulative conversation history over hours or days.
Can I self-host Splyntra on my own Kubernetes cluster?
Yes. Splyntra's core is source-available and can be self-hosted via Docker Compose or Helm charts on any cloud provider.
